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Psoriasis patients: Adults (m/f) with a mild form of psoriasis vulgaris (PASI score of maximal 12). Patients are allowed to use local corticosteroids or ointments to prevent dry skin (Appendix 2).

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: These patients have not received light therapy or another form of systemic treatments (methotrexate, cyclosporin A, anti-TNF treatments). Gender or age of the adults are not exclusion criteria (Appendix 2)

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Effect on the psoriatic process is tested by histology and immuno-histochemical techniques in the transplanted biopsies. Main read-out is epidermal thickness.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
RNA will be isolated from the biopsies and analyzed on important gene transcripts that appear to play a role in the development of psoriasis. Secretion of inflammatory mediators by cells from patients. Markers on cultured cells from psoriasis patients. Additionally, effects of the compounds will be evaluated on the immune cells derived from blood of the patients (in vitro) , this in parallel to the in vivo mouse study. Possibly also inflammatory cells in the skin tissue will be evaluated
